What Is MaxAi Trader?
MaxAi Trader is an automated trading system — an Expert Advisor (EA) — that executes a rules-based strategy on MetaTrader. It was founded by Daniel Krings and is built around three priorities: defined risk, verified live performance, and reliable execution.
This page is an educational overview of how the system works and the factors that influence its results. It is not financial advice or a guarantee of performance.
What It Does
MaxAi Trader automates a complete trading process. Rather than requiring a trader to manually watch charts and place orders, the software follows a predefined set of rules to:
- Analyze the market for qualifying conditions
- Open and close positions automatically
- Apply stop-loss and take-profit levels
- Manage position sizing and exposure
- Operate continuously while connected to the market
In other words, it is a tool for executing a strategy consistently and without emotional interference. As with any trading bot, the software is the executor — the underlying strategy and risk controls are what matter most.

VPS Setup
Like most automated systems, MaxAi Trader is designed to run continuously. A VPS (Virtual Private Server) keeps the platform online 24 hours a day with stable connectivity, independent of a home computer or internet connection.
Server location also matters: lower latency to the broker can improve execution consistency. This is why a VPS located near the broker’s servers is generally recommended for automated trading.
Broker Support
MaxAi Trader runs on MetaTrader and can be used with brokers that support automated trading. Because execution quality varies between brokers, broker selection can meaningfully influence real-world results.
Factors such as liquidity, spreads, commissions, and slippage all play a role — which is why identical systems can produce different results across accounts. Guidance on configuring an appropriate environment is covered in the best broker setup for trading bots.
